    Heart Who's your favorite comicbook artist?

    Mine? Curt Swan will always be the man to me. As a kid, when I doodled a lot, I also tried to emulate his work.

    Yes, everyone he drew looked the same, but when I think of Superman, it's always a Curt Swan picture that comes to mind.

    Who is YOUR favorite comicbook artist of all time?

    Curt Swan is awesome. Over the years, I think ive come to appreciate him more and more. True draftmanship and he could tell a great story with pictures. He style changed with the times to and he managed to keep himself from becoming stagnant.

    Its hard to pick just one. Gil Kane, Jack Kirby, John Buscema, Jack Davis, Neil Adams......

    I might have to say John Byrne just because he was the artist that I actually read on a regular basis thru the years. From FF to superman to NextMen to superman again i usually picked up what he did no matter the book. Thru all the trends thru the years he remained consistent.

    The truely great comic artist ive learned to appreciate as time has gone on with better access to their material.

    Honarable mention goes to Sergio Aragones. Ive always enjoyed his doodles and was a fan of Groo

    They tough part about naming one artist is that for certain characters I have a specific artists whom I like better than others. For example, Curt Swan is my favorite Superman artist, but his style just did not suit the bronze-age Batman (my favorite version) to me. So while he is the definitive and my favorite artist for my favorite character, I don't think his style was as versatile or fit every feature.

    Overall, I'm not a big fan of Ditko's style, but he's my favorite Spider-Man artist.

    So I guess, overall it's probably George Perez, but I also love Adams, Byrne, Kane, Aparo, Lopez, Kirby, and a dozen(s) others.

    Would love for DC to get Perez to do a 12-issue run on a Justice League book with the Satellite lineup. I know he did a number of issues following the passing of Dick Dillin, but his run was fractured with Don Heck doing issues between his.
